Article 23
 

Voter lists



1. In order to organise and hold an election the following voter lists shall be compiled:


1) the voter list of the Republic of Lithuania (National Voter List);


2) voter lists of municipalities; and


3) Voter list for Precincts.



2. Voter lists shall be drawn up twice – preliminary and final. These lists may be used only for organisation and holding of an election.



3. The procedure for compiling voter lists must be such that every citizen of the Republic of Lithuania who is entitled to vote shall be entered on voter lists. No one may be entered on a voter list more than once.



4. The National Voter List and voter lists of municipalities shall be drawn up and kept electronically by the CEC in cooperation with the management body of the Residents' Register of the Republic of Lithuania. Voter list for Precincts shall be printed. The procedure, form, method of compiling voter lists and the procedure of their use shall be laid down by the CEC.
When drawing up voter lists, the following personal data shall be used:


1) in the National voter list: name, surname, personal number, date of birth, number of the personal document confirming the citizenship, the address of the place of residence;


2) in the municipal voter list: name, surname, personal number, date of birth, address of the place of residence;


3) in the Voter list for Precinct: name, surname and address of the place of residence. The home address of a voter who has expressed disagreement about her/his home address appearing in Voter list for Precinct shall be indicated only in the annex to Voter list for Precinct and in the Voter card.


 


5. Every voter shall have the right to express disagreement about her/his home address being made public in Voter list for Precinct. The CEC shall, together with the management body of the Residents’ Register, take the necessary measures to enable a voter to express disagreement about her/his home address being made public in Voter list for Precinct.
